发明名称 HYBRID SIMPLE SEWAGE TREATMENT METHOD AND APPARATUS HAVING HIGH-SPEED SEDIMENTATION AND FLOATATION
摘要 <p>The present invention provides a rapid sedimentation and floatation-combined type simple sewage treatment method and an apparatus thereof wherein the method comprises: an inflow step of letting sewage flow into an inflow tank via an inlet; a rapid reaction step of inputting a coagulant into the sewage having flown into a rapid reaction tank from the inflow tank, agitating and rapidly mixing and reacting the sewage and the coagulant by a rapid reaction and agitation unit to aggregate the sewage and the coagulant into fine floc; an aggregation step of inputting the coagulant into the sewage with the floc flowing into an aggregation tank from the rapid reaction tank and agitating and slowly mixing and reacting the sewage with the floc and the coagulant to aggregate the sewage and the coagulant into grown floc; a rapid sedimentation step of letting the sewage with the grown floc overflow upwards from the aggregation tank and flow into a rapid sedimentation and floatation tank, and letting the floc rapidly sink by a collision to a fluid rectifying plate inversely inclined in the front of the rapid sedimentation and floatation tank to be deposited into sludge; a floatation step of supplying pressurized water, including compressed air, to the rapid sedimentation and floatation tank and generating fine air bubbles to let floating materials float to a floating space; a floating sludge removal step of removing the floating sludge collected in the floating space by using a floating sludge remover to make the sludge flow in a sludge storage tank; and a treated water outflow step of making treated water, having been subjected to solid-liquid separation by the rapid sedimentation and floatation tank, flow into the treated water storage tank and discharging the treated water to the outside via an outflow tank.</p>
